Způsoby platby Abuse

Jak vymazat tabulku v systému MySQL

13.04.2023, 02:53

Tabulka v systému MySQL je strukturované úložiště dat, které se používá k ukládání a organizaci informací v databázi. Každá tabulka se skládá ze sloupců (polí), které definují typ dat, a řádků (záznamů), které obsahují aktuální hodnoty. V některých případech je třeba tabulku vyčistit. Jak to v systému Linux udělat?

Co jsou to tabulky MySQL

Tabulky v systému MySQL lze propojovat pomocí vztahů, například klíčů, což umožňuje vytvářet složitější datové struktury a efektivně vyhledávat, třídit a filtrovat informace. V MySQL můžete například vytvořit tabulku uživatelů s poli, jako je jméno, příjmení, e-mailová adresa, heslo atd. nebo tabulku objednávek s poli, jako je číslo objednávky, datum objednávky, jméno zákazníka, částka objednávky atd.

Proč je třeba tabulku vyčistit

Vyčištění tabulky v systému MySQL může být nutné z několika důvodů:
  1. Zbavení se starých nebo nepotřebných dat může zlepšit výkon databáze, protože dotazy budou probíhat rychleji.
  2. Může pomoci odstranit problémy s velikostí databáze. Pokud je tabulka příliš velká, může to vést k omezení místa na disku a zpomalení serveru.
  3. Po vyčištění tabulky lze provést optimalizaci tabulky, která pomůže zlepšit její výkon.
  4. Může pomoci zlepšit celkové zabezpečení databáze, protože v ní nebudou nevyužitá data, která by mohli útočníci využít k získání přístupu k citlivým údajům.
  5. V některých případech může být vyčištění tabulky nezbytné k provedení údržby databáze nebo k úspěšnému testování.

Pokyny pro čištění

K vyčištění tabulky v systému MySQL v Linuxu můžete použít příkaz TRUNCATE.

Pomocí tohoto příkazu přistupte do konzoly databáze MySQL:

mysql -u username -p

kde `username` je jméno uživatele MySQL.

Vyberte požadovanou databázi:

USE DATA_BASE_NAME;

Vyčistěte tabulku pomocí příkazu:

TRUNCATE TABLE TABLE_NAME;

kde `TABLE_NAME` je název tabulky, kterou chcete vymazat.

Ukončete konzolu MySQL:

exit